Our General Dentistry Services Will Help You Smile For Years

We offer quality general dentistry treatments to benefit every family member, including:

  • Dental Cleanings and Exams – These essential services ensure we catch cavities before they become major issues and also prevent other dental problems, such as oral cancer.
  • Dental Sealants – Thin coatings applied to teeth protect your smile from damaging decay that can lead to expensive treatments or tooth loss.
  • Fluoride Treatments and Varnish – Fluoride further fights against tooth decay. It is especially beneficial for younger smiles, since kids are more likely to have cavities.
  • Nutritional Counseling – We include with your exam to help all members of your household enjoy better oral and overall health.
  • Dry Mouth Treatment – We can recommend helpful products to  relieve you of daily discomfort.
  • Bad Breath/Halitosis Treatment – Improve your confidence and feel better about laughing or speaking around others. Treatment also ensures your oral health, since bad breath is a common symptom of gum disease.
  • Nonsurgical Gum Disease Treatment – Scaling and root planing (deep cleaning) gets rid of tartar and plaque. You can also receive laser treatment to speed up recovery and minimize bleeding during your procedure.
  • Customized Mouthguards – They keep you and your family members safe during athletic activities and also prevent issues caused by teeth grinding (also known as bruxism).

How long is general dentistry school?

If a person wants to become a dentist, they must first complete their undergraduate degree before they can apply for dental school. After four years of dental school, they will receive their dental degree and can practice general dentistry. In addition, a dentist must complete continuing education credits each year to maintain their license.

Should I get fluoride treatment?

Sugar and bacteria in your mouth form acids that eat into your tooth enamel, causing cavities. Fluoride and other minerals strengthen your enamel and help fortify it against these kinds of attacks. If you are prone to cavities, fluoride treatments can help you avoid them. Of course, it’s also important to brush and floss every day and to cut down on sugary foods and drinks.
